Understanding the Factors That Influence Jiffy Lube Oil Change Pricing
Unlike independent shops, Jiffy Lube operates on a franchise model where pricing can fluctuate based on location, local market conditions, and the specific services rendered. Furthermore, the specific blend of oil—conventional, synthetic blend, or full synthetic—directly impacts the price, with synthetic options commanding a premium due to their performance characteristics and longevity.
